[Linux] Bug with fresh install of linux mint
I just spent 20 minutes trying to get steam to work on a new install of Linux mint.

I had to refer to a forum post from last year where an issue with the steam client forcing GPU rendering will make steam constantly try to relaunch itself over and over again, with no way to functionality use steam.

Maybe because Steam Deck uses Arch rather than Debian

Is there a way to make the steam client on linux detect crashes and maybe make the program disable hardware acceleration after 5 successive crashes
